Who is Maggie Lawson’s ex-husband, Ben Koldyke? Wiki bio
Benjamin ‘Ben’ Koldyke was born in Chicago, Illinois USA, on March 27, 1968, so his zodiac sign is Aries and he is an American national. He’s an actor, best known for playing the supporting character Officer Tommy Johnson in the 2003 comedy film “Stuck on You”, starring Matt Damon and Greg Kinnear and which follows conjoined twins who come to Los Angeles so that one of them can become an actor can become . Meryl Streep and Eva Mendes, who also starred in the film, were each nominated for an award.
Early life and education
Ben was raised as a single child in Kenilworth, Illinois, by his mother Patricia Blunt Koldyke who worked at the investment firm Laird Norton Company, and his father Martin J. Mike Koldyke who was an investment banker best known for launching the Frontenac Company, which by 2017 had invested more than $1.5 billion in more than 200 partnerships.
Ben attended New Trier High School, where he was interested in football, and played for the school’s team with a 14-0 record, but they eventually lost in the state championship. After taking his matriculation exam in 1986, he enrolled at Choate Rosemary Hall, then transferred to Dartmouth College, graduating in 1990 with a bachelor’s degree in English; while there, he played football for the university’s team.
Appearances in TV series
After graduating from college, Ben began teaching English and football at a local high school in Chicago while occasionally appearing in movies and TV series. In 2008, he met Rob McElhenney who starred in the series “It’s Always Sunny in Philadelphia”, and who invited him to appear in more serious TV shows, giving Ben the recognition he needed.
Ben made his TV series debut in 2004, portraying a Los Angeles Police Department officer in the action drama series “24”while in 2009 he appeared in some episodes of series such as the comedy “Boldly Going Nowhere”, the award-winning sitcom “It’s Always Sunny in Philadelphia” and the comedy “The Big D”.
He won his first recurring role in 2010, playing Dale Tomasson in five episodes of the drama series ‘Big Love’ before being invited to guest star as Don Frank in six episodes of the hit sitcom ‘How I Met Your Mother’. , starring Josh Radnor, Jason Segel and Cobie Smulders, among others, and which follows the story of a man who spent years having fun with his four friends before meeting his future wife. The series was a huge success, winning 25 awards and being nominated for 91 others, including two Golden Globes.
In 2012, Ben played one of the lead roles of Lee Standish in 11 episodes of the sitcom “Work It”, before guest starring in an episode of the political drama series “The Newsroom” in 2013.
In the next three years, he only played recurring characters in series such as the live action family “Gortimer Gibbon’s Life on Normal Street”, the sitcom “Mr. Robinson”, and the historical drama “Masters of Sex”.
Some of his latest TV series appearances were in the comedies “Curb Your Enthusiasm” in 2017 and “Silicon Valley” in 2018, and the fantasy comedy “The Good Place” in 2019.
Roles in movies
Ben made his screen debut in 2000, playing Kelly’s Boyfriend in the comedy-drama “The Next Best Thing”, starring Madonna, Rupert Everett and Benjamin Bratt, which follows a woman who sleeps with her gay boyfriend, and after she gets pregnant they decide to raise the baby together; the film won three awards and was nominated for 10 others. The same year, Ben played a supporting character in the historical political thriller film “Thirteen Days”, starring Kevin Costner and Bruce Greenwood.

In 2001, he wrote, directed and starred in the comedy film “Red Zone”, which received mixed reviews, and in 2002 wrote and directed the comedy film “Osama Bin Laden: Behind the Madness”, which follows an interviewer talking to Osama about his terrorist activities. In 2003, Ben played a supporting character in the romantic drama comedy “Say I Do”, starring David Bel Ayche and Samuel Bliss Cooper and which follows two people who were about to have a perfect wedding until something unexpected happened. The film won 17 awards, while Ben received a Special Jury for Acting Award for Special Mention Actor at the Gasparilla International Film Festival.
Some of Ben’s last appearances in movies were in the 2008 comedy short “Jedi Gym” which he also wrote, and the action thriller “The Finest Hours” where he played Sam in 2016.
Love life and marriage with Ben Koldyke
Ben met Maggie Lawson while they were working on the “Back in the Game” series together in 2013, and they started dating soon after. Nearly two years later, on August 8, 2015, the two married in a private ceremony in Las Vegas at Ben’s family ranch, but the marriage lasted less than two years. as they divorced in early 2017. Rumor has it that the two broke up because Maggie wanted to focus on her career while Ben wanted to start a family.

Who is Maggie Lawson? Wiki bio
Maggie Cassidy Lawson was born in Louisville, Kentucky USA on August 12, 1980 – her zodiac sign is Leo and she is an American national. She is an actress who gained recognition after playing Detective Juliet ‘Jules’ O’Hara in the detective comedy-drama series ‘Psych’.
Maggie was raised in Louisville by her father Mike Lawson, who was a hotel manager, and her mother Judy, who was a housewife. Maggie studied at St. Stephen Martyr School before attending Assumption High School where she became interested in acting, appearing in several plays performed at the school. After her matriculation exam in 1998, she decided not to enroll in a university but to pursue her dream of becoming a famous actress.
She appeared in her first play when she was eight, and at the age of 12 she was the host of the children’s show “Kid’s Club”, which aired on WDRB Fox 41.
She made her debut in the TV series at the age of 16, playing Madelyn in four episodes of the sitcom “Unhappily Ever After”, followed by her appearances in some episodes of various series, such as “Step by Step”, ” Meego ”, and “Kelly Kelly” among others.
She gained recognition in 2001 when she played the main character Eve in the sitcom ‘Inside Schwartz’, and then regular characters in the sitcoms ‘It’s All Relative’ in 2003 and ‘Crumbs’ in 2006. In the following years, Maggie appeared in several series and movies – some of her last roles were in the Christmas movie “Christmas in Evergreen: Tidings of Joy” in 2019, the sitcom “Outmatched” where she played the main character Kay, and the crime mystery movie “Psych 2 : Lassie Come Home” in which she will star in early 2020 starred as Juliet O’Hara.
